C++类定义与使用的基本语法

 时间:2026-02-14 11:54:57

1、类的声明和函数的声明很像,都可以写在主函数的前面:

class Intcell

{

public:

      Intcell( )

            { storedvalue = 0; }

      Intcell(int init){storedvalue=init;}

      void write(int x){storedvalue=x;}

      int read(){return storedvalue;}

private:

      int storedvalue;

};

这里,我们声明了一个叫Intcell的类。

C++类定义与使用的基本语法

2、这一个类包括两个标签:PublicPrivate。

Public中的成员是外部可以通过类的对象进行访问的,就如他的名字公开的。

Private内的数据是不可再外部直接访问的。

C++类定义与使用的基本语法

3、类主要包括两类成员,数据和成员函数。

成员函数一般叫做方法

C++类定义与使用的基本语法

4、构造函数一般用于初始化对象。

Intcell( )

            { storedvalue = 0; }

Intcell(int init){storedvalue=init;}

C++类定义与使用的基本语法

5、主程序建立一个对象并初始化:

 Intcell m(6);

C++类定义与使用的基本语法

6、成员方法的使用:

m.read():读取存储的数据

m.write(6):写入存储的数据

C++类定义与使用的基本语法

7、结果:

6

7符合条件。

C++类定义与使用的基本语法

8、全部代码如下:

#include <iostream>

using namespace std;

class Intcell

{

public:

      Intcell( )

            { storedvalue = 0; }

      Intcell(int init){storedvalue=init;}

      void write(int x){storedvalue=x;}

      int read(){return storedvalue;}

private:

      int storedvalue;

};

int main()

{

    Intcell m(6);

    cout<<m.read()<<endl;

    m.write(7);

    cout<<m.read()<<endl;

    return 0;

}

C++类定义与使用的基本语法

  • Visual C++6.0怎么调试程序
  • C#里的SQL语句in的多个参数怎么用
  • 什么方法可以缓解近视眼
  • 不良人手游藏兵谷门怎么开
  • MATLAB绘制3D彩色阴影浮雕地形图
  • 热门搜索
    社会调查方法 找狗很灵的方法 去痘痘的方法 六合大全 臊子面的家常做法 食谱大全 开车怎么判断左右距离 两边脸不对称怎么办 睡莲的种植方法 淘宝旗舰店怎么申请